Zorro has been been in our care now for a number of months after a long stay at the pound. He might not look much like a Husky, but Zorro is registered as a Husky X which is why we were asked to help him.
Zorro was surrendered due to his owners moving overseas, they say he is a Husky x Bulldog but we are not convinced, maybe a bit of Lab or even Akita? He’s quite a big goofy boy and can be a bit boisterous, jump up and get a bit mouthy when excited, however with training he has settled down a lot and will now sit when instructed. so he will need some training and to learn some lead manners.
He is said to be social and non-reactive around other dogs, so he may be suitable for a home with a friendly female doggy companion of similar size who can tolerate some rough play.
His surrender form says he has been around cats and young children, however as we don’t know enough about him we will require any children to be at least in their teens and caution would need to be taken with cats and other small animals.
As with all our dogs, Zorro will need a secure yard with fencing at least 6 foot high and walks must always be on lead.
Zorro is not available for interstate adoption and is not suitable for apartments, homes with small yards or rural areas.
